CDN服务器是什么?CDN服务器能做什么?站长用大白话讲清楚
很多新手站长第一次接触CDN,都会被一堆专业术语绕晕:节点、回源、缓存、加速……其实CDN服务器的本质特别简单,一句话就能概括:CDN服务器就是帮你把网站内容“复制”到全球各地的小服务器,让用户从最近的地方拿数据,从而让网站打开更快、更稳定。

一、CDN服务器到底是什么?
CDN的全称是Content Delivery Network,中文叫内容分发网络。
它的工作方式就像:
你在北京有一台主服务器(源站);
CDN在上海、广州、香港、新加坡、东京等地方放了很多“小服务器”;
这些小服务器会自动缓存你网站的图片、CSS、JS、视频等静态资源;
当用户访问你的网站时,系统会自动把用户引导到离他最近的小服务器;
用户从最近的服务器拿数据,速度自然就快了。
所以,CDN服务器就是分布在各地的“缓存服务器”,它们的任务就是:
缓存你的网站内容
让用户就近访问
减轻源站压力
提高访问速度和稳定性
二、CDN服务器是怎么工作的?(用生活例子讲)
你可以把网站想象成一家“工厂”,用户是“顾客”。
没有CDN时:所有顾客都跑到北京工厂买东西,人多了就堵,远的顾客还得跑很远。
有了CDN后:你在全国开了很多“便利店”(CDN节点),把热门商品(图片、视频、CSS等)放在便利店里。顾客就近去便利店买,速度快、工厂压力也小。
这就是CDN的核心原理。
三、CDN服务器能做什么?(站长最关心的功能)
1. 提升网站打开速度
用户从最近的节点访问,延迟更低,加载更快。
例如:
源站在北京,深圳用户访问可能要80-120ms;
用了CDN后,深圳用户访问深圳节点,可能只要20-40ms。
2. 减轻源站压力
图片、视频、JS等静态资源都由CDN节点提供,源站只需要处理动态内容(如接口、登录等),压力大幅降低。
3. 防御DDoS攻击
CDN节点会替源站“挡子弹”,大量攻击流量会被CDN清洗掉,源站更安全。
4. 支持大文件下载和视频播放
视频网站、下载站几乎都离不开CDN,否则源站带宽会被瞬间打满。
5. 智能调度
CDN会根据用户的运营商、地理位置、网络状况,自动选择最快的节点。
四、CDN服务器和普通服务器有什么区别?
| 对比项 | CDN服务器 | 普通服务器(源站) |
|---|---|---|
| 作用 | 缓存并分发内容 | 处理业务逻辑、存储原始数据 |
| 位置 | 分布在全球各地 | 通常在一个或少数几个地区 |
| 面向用户 | 直接面向所有访问用户 | 主要面向CDN回源或动态请求 |
| 内容类型 | 静态资源(图片、视频、CSS、JS) | 动态内容+静态内容 |
| 带宽要求 | 极高 | 相对较低(有CDN的情况下) |
| 价格 | 按流量计费,成本较低 | 按配置计费,成本较高 |
五、哪些网站必须用CDN?
有图片、视频、下载资源的网站
日访问量较大的网站
用户分布在全国或全球的网站
电商网站、资讯网站、论坛、博客
对访问速度要求高的网站
一句话:只要你的网站有用户,就应该用CDN。
六、免备案cdn和国内备案CDN有什么区别?
国内备案CDN:
节点在中国大陆
速度最快
需要网站备案
免备案CDN:
节点在香港、澳门、台湾、新加坡等境外地区
不需要备案
国内访问速度比国内CDN稍慢,但比直接访问境外源站快很多
适合:个人站长、外贸站、出海业务、无法备案的项目。
七、总结(一句话记住)
CDN服务器就是分布在全球的缓存服务器,让用户从最近的地方访问你的网站,从而让网站更快、更稳、更安全。
11评选建议,无论你是做个人博客、企业官网还是电商平台,都应该配置CDN,它是提升网站体验最有效的方式之一。